    Yo, East Side Teach...If this trend is inevitable, Here is what I would like to see, Let's make it a hypothetical 18 game season

    1) 2 bye weeks, both " around " the 1/3 and 2/3 points of the season
    2) Significantly increase the roster AND practice squad
    3) Now here's where I want to put my own personal twist on it, The " Disco rule " lol...

    EVERY player will still only be ALLOWED to play a 16 game season...Talk about coaching...With the expanded roster and practice squad...There would be so much strategy and risks bring taken...
    Ex) Do you rest Ben against the " ****tier " teams, and roll the dice? Play ALL of your BEST players against the Cheats, Ravens, Chiefs, ...Lesser lineups against lesser teams and cross your fingers...

    The strategy would be insane, and there would be so much to talk about between us , and the big national TV shows...Some teams will be disrespected with lineups put against them...And chirp accordingly to the cameras...

    And lastly ( fantasy football ) I'm in a league with my good friends...Talk about strategy, and planning, and **** talking...And LUCK! Week 12 and your team has say Mahommes, Mixon, and say George Kittle all out that game...Will make for tremendous talk and feedback on those sites and amongst FFL players...Instead of basically just plugging in your " regular " lineup for the most part... IMO, I think it would be interesting and at the same time, Still have the welfare of the players themselves protected

    I get where you are coming from as it would save some wear and tear on the players. Good idea in that regards. Yes, two less games may not seem like much to the average person but in the brutal game of the NFL it would definitely help alleviate some of that pounding these guys take week in and week out.

    However, this would in all likelihood cause a grumbling amongst the average fans who maybe go to a game once a year, if even that. When they go to a game, they want to see their favorite players. So for instance, if Ben sits out against Team A, I know I am not going to that game and neither would probably over half the fan-base. There would be a lot of empty seats for that game.

    Yes, it would cause a lot of strategic planning for both teams. If Ben sits out then the opposition will probably want to sit out one of their best players for that game as well. Yes, as you stated: "There would be so much strategy and risks bring taken".

    And then how about the greedy owners? If they are mandated to sit everyone out for two games, they will see it as two games of lost revenue to some degree. Even down to the last kernel of popcorn that would not get sold.
